Simona Halep Pulls Through a Tough Battle Against Elena Rybakina at US Open 2021

As the third round matches at the US Open 2021 got underway, the returning Simona Halep took to court on Friday. She kicked off the morning session on the Louis Armstrong stadium, looking to seal her spot in Round-4. Her opponent on the day was Kazakhstan’s Elena Rybakina. Shaking off all the possible rust, Halep secured a sensational victory.

Monumental effort from Simona Halep in Set-1

USA Today via Reuters

It was a slow start from the Romanian, who went down an early break at 0-2. Rybakina was serving very well, constantly finding the corners on her first serve. She was proving to be a menace for the 12th seed, going up 3-1. In the sixth game, Simona Halep strung together a brilliant return game, characterized by some uncanny first serve misses from Rybakina. As the rest of the set progressed, Halep continued to play the catch-up game, before eventually dragging the set to a tiebreaker.

In the tiebreak that followed, it was an absolute battle between the duo. Neither player was willing to give in, fighting point for point. There was no clear winner in the race-to-seven, meaning that additional points were required to secure the set. After multiple set points went begging, Halep finally took the first set off a double fault by 7-6 (11).

Rybakina claws her way back, but in vain

via Reuters

The second set started off in similar fashion to the first, with the 19th seed racing to a lead. However, Halep was back in the game again, courtesy of some crucial double faults from the Kazakh. The rallies were short and crisp, but Rybakina began controlling the play more often. After a bumpy couple of games, she found some rhythm again to break Halep. With her aces comfortably crossing the double digit mark, she powered her way through the former World No.1 to take the set 6-4.

With the match being interrupted numerous times due to some minor injuries for both players, the clock ticked past the 2 hour mark. Nonetheless, it was the player from Kazakhstan who took the bull by the horns yet again, breaking Simona in the very first game.

The 2-time Slam winner didn’t have the natural weapon like her opponent, and was quite tired. She extended the rallies from well behind the baseline, as the long rallies always favor her. Accompanied by another drop in the service level of Rybakina, Simona Halep never looked back after the first game. She destroyed her opponent for a pleasing 7-6 4-6 6-3 victory.

The dream return for Simona Halep thus continues at the US Open 2021. Next up for the former Wimbledon champion, is a mouth-watering fourth round tussle against either Olympic bronze medalist Elina Svitolina or Russia’s Daria Kasatkina.
